Key Considerations When Selecting Wood for Construction and Design

Not all timber is created equal. Depending on whether your application is indoor, outdoor, decorative, or structural, different physical properties must be prioritized.

1. Structural Integrity vs. Aesthetic Grain

  • Structural Uses: Beams (vigas), joists, and framing require high load-bearing capacity and dimensional stability. Pine and fir are common choices for framing, while heavy hardwood gualdras offer reliable support for large architectural spans.
  • Aesthetic & Decorative Uses: Fine furniture, cabinetry, and feature walls benefit from distinct grain patterns and unique color profiles found in premium hardwoods.

2. Environmental Resistance

Outdoor decks, exterior cladding, and pergolas demand wood that can withstand moisture, UV exposure, and insect pressure. Pressure-treated pine or naturally oil-rich tropical hardwoods provide long-term resistance against rot and warping.

3. Sustainability and Certification

Responsible forestry practices ensure that timber harvesting supports long-term ecological balance. Sourcing certified wood protects forest ecosystems while delivering traceable, high-quality materials to job sites.

Exploring Specialty & Exotic Wood Species

Beyond standard construction pine, incorporating specialty hardwoods elevates interior design and high-end building projects.

Wood SpeciesKey CharacteristicsCommon Applications
Pine (Pino)Versatile, workable, cost-effectiveStructural framing, pine boards, cabinetry
American OakDense, strong, distinct prominent grainHardwood flooring, premium furniture, cabinetry
AyacahuiteSoft, fine-textured, highly workableIntricate carving, interior molding, light carpentry
Brazilian TeakExceptionally dense, water-resistantOutdoor decking, heavy-duty flooring, exterior features
SiricoteRare, striking dark figure and grainCustom artisan furniture, musical instruments, accent pieces

Practical Applications: From Structural Beams to Fine Woodworking

Structural Beams and Heavy Framing

Large timber beams are fundamental for rustic residential designs, open-ceiling concepts, and heavy commercial construction. Proper kiln-drying and treatment prevent cracking and sagging over decades of load-bearing performance.

Exterior Decking and Finishes

Using pressure-treated lumber or dense hardwoods for outdoor spaces ensures longevity. Regular sealing and proper spacing for air circulation will further extend the service life of exterior wood installations.

Custom DIY Projects and Furniture

For makers and custom furniture builders, selecting stable, well-milled boards reduces preparation time. Hardwoods like American Oak and Siricote offer unmatched durability and visual depth when finished with natural oils or clear lacquers.

Best Practices for Timber Storage and Job-Site Preparation

To maintain the quality of your wood before and during installation, follow these essential site management rules:

  1. Acclimation: Allow timber to sit on-site for at least 48 to 72 hours before installation so it adjusts to the local humidity and temperature.
  2. Elevated Storage: Keep wood elevated off the ground using dunnage or stickers to prevent moisture absorption from soil or concrete.
  3. Proper Ventilation: Cover outdoor stack piles with a breathable tarp to protect against rain while allowing air circulation to prevent mold growth.

Frequently Asked Questions (FAQs)

Why is pressure-treated wood recommended for outdoor projects?

Pressure treatment forces protective preservatives deep into the wood fibers, shielding it from rot, fungal decay, and wood-boring insects.

What is the advantage of using certified wood?

Certified wood guarantees that the timber was harvested from responsibly managed forests, adhering to strict environmental, social, and economic standards.

How do I choose between softwoods and hardwoods?

Softwoods (like pine) are generally lighter, easier to work with, and ideal for structural framing and general carpentry. Hardwoods (like Oak and Teak) are denser, more scratch-resistant, and suited for high-wear areas and fine finishing.
